Logic Gate Implementation: Determining Output and Function Inputs, Assignments of Electrical and Electronics Engineering

Instructions for determining the output of a pass-gate implementation and identifying the function inputs for various logical functions using a pass-gate tree.

Typology: Assignments

Pre 2010

Uploaded on 08/04/2009

koofers-user-bm8
koofers-user-bm8 🇺🇸

9 documents

1 / 1

Toggle sidebar

This page cannot be seen from the preview

Don't miss anything!

bg1
Logical Unit
A designer bungled this pass-gate implementation of a generic logic gate (4 to 1 mux).
F1
F3
F0
F2
Out
YX
Remember that pass-gates are ideal switches that close when the control signal is high, and open when
the control signal is low. We'll ignore the complemented control signal here.
Part A
Determine which input is passed to the output under the following control conditions. Complete
the left-hand table below.
Part B
Using this pass-gate tree, what are the function inputs (
F
0
;F
1
;F
2
;F
3
) for the logical functions
listed in the right-hand table below?
Y X Out function
F
3
F
2
F
1
F
0
0 0 AND
0 1 XOR
1 0
X
1 1
X
+
Y

Partial preview of the text

Download Logic Gate Implementation: Determining Output and Function Inputs and more Assignments Electrical and Electronics Engineering in PDF only on Docsity!

Logical Unit

A designer bungled this pass-gate implementation of a generic logic gate (4 to 1 mux).

F

F

F

F

Out

X Y

Rememb er that pass-gates are ideal switches that close when the control signal is high, and op en when the control signal is low. We'll ignore the complemented control signal here.

Part A Determine which input is passed to the output under the following control conditions. Complete the left-hand table b elow.

Part B Using this pass-gate tree, what are the function inputs (F 0 ; F 1 ; F 2 ; F 3 ) for the logical functions listed in the right-hand table b elow?

Y X Out function F 3 F 2 F 1 F 0

0 0 AND

0 1 XOR

1 0 X

1 1 X + Y